From MAC Media Day- Commissioner Jon Steinbrecher talks UMass' departure.
Quote:With Temple's decision, the conference could have altered its contract with UMass right then and there, he commissioner said, but decided against it due to the uncertainty of ongoing realignment.

"We wanted to step back, because of what was going on in the environment. There were a lot of changes going on and we felt there was some safety in numbers," he said. "We thought there might be a possibility of maybe there was someone else we might want to bring in that made some sense."

That never happened and the conference stuck at 13 teams and two uneven divisions of six and seven members. Faced with the eventual decision to commit, UMass declined, citing considerable financial and geographic issues.

Steinbrecher acknowledged there was little hope UMass would reconsider.

"It got down to the point where it was like 'Look, if you want to come all in, that's great. If you don't, we'll understand and we'll go our separate ways,'" he said. "Certainly, for the next two years, we'd like to think UMass will feel like an insider and we know they'll be treated in that fashion.

"But yes, it's challenging. I know (UMass athletic director) John McCutcheon and his staff are working hard to come up with solutions."

Though UMass faces an uncertain future – one that more and more realistically features the potential for some measure of independency – Steinbrecher still believes the school to be an attractive target for potential suitors.

The Minutemen's growing basketball clout is an important piece. An improved football product under new coach Mark Whipple will help more.

Quote:UMass declined, citing considerable financial and geographic issues.

I don't understand, how is the MAC a geographic issue for UMass? With the MAC you've got 12 schools between 600-1,000 miles away. The range for CUSA schools is 750-2,300 miles and only 1 school is within the MAC range (Marshall). With the American UConn and Temple are closer than any MAC school and Cinci and maybe ECU are within the MAC range, but then the rest of the teams are in FL and TX and such. The average distance is still going to be much larger. (Its worth noting that neither CUSA or AAC have any interest in adding UMass.)

Name a conference in FBS that has an average travel distance shorter than the MAC does for UMass. I think UMass is hung up on the dream of being "big time" and aren't facing the facts.
